Inputs and outputs
MPC4 / IOC4T CARD PAIR
4.4.3 Analog outputs
The MPC4 and IOC4T card pair provides a buffered transducer “raw” output for each of its
four dynamic signal inputs and the two tachometer (speed) inputs.
For the dynamic signal inputs, each buffered output is an analog signal that is a replica of the
transducer input signal for the channel including both AC and DC components (single-ended,
referenced to ground).
The transfer ratio for the buffered outputs of dynamic channels depends on the configured
signal transmission mode for the input:
• For a voltage input, the transfer ratio is 1 V/V.
That is, with a dynamic channel configured for a voltage input, the signal level
(amplitude) of the buffered output is the same as the input signal from the transducers.
• For a current input, the transfer ratio is 0.3245 V/mA.
That is, with a dynamic channel configured for a current input, the signal level (amplitude)
of the buffered output is a product of the transmitted current and the current measuring
resistor (324.5 Ω) at the dynamic signal input.
For the dynamic signal inputs, the buffered outputs are available on BNC connectors on the
MPC4 card (see 4.4.3.1 Front panel analog outputs (MPC4)) and on screw-terminal
connectors on the IOC4T card (see 4.4.3.2 Rear panel analog outputs (IOC4T)).
For the tachometer (speed) signal inputs, each buffered output is a digital signal that is a
level-shifted replica of the transducer input signal for the channel (single-ended, referenced
to ground).
For a speed channel, the signal level (amplitude) of the buffered output is a 0 to 5 V
TTL-compatible signal.
For the speed signal inputs, the buffered outputs are available on BNC connectors on the
MPC4 card (see 4.4.3.1 Front panel analog outputs (MPC4)).
NOTE: All of the analog outputs are buffered and can support short-circuits or input pulses
without internal interference.
4.4.3.1 Front panel analog outputs (MPC4)
The MPC4 panel is equipped with 6 BNC connectors, intended for the connection of
laboratory instruments:
• Four connectors for raw dynamic signals (AC and DC, if applicable).
These are named RAW OUT 1, RAW OUT 2, RAW OUT 3 and RAW OUT 4.
• Two connectors for processed speed outputs (TTL format).
These are named TACHO OUT 1 and TACHO OUT 2.
4.4.3.2 Rear panel analog outputs (IOC4T)
Buffered raw signals from the sensors (for example, corresponding to vibration) are available
for connection to external racks or other equipment for further analysis such as condition
monitoring.
These differential outputs (RAW 1H and RAW 1L, RAW 2H and RAW 2L, RAW 3H and
RAW 3L, and RAW 4H and RAW 4L) are accessible on the IOC4T card.
The same bandwidth and accuracy specifications apply as per the BNC outputs on the MPC4
panel.
